    Does anyone know how Simmed stats work?

    Maybe this is a question for Kush or someone else with experience in the field, but does anyone know or have a basic understanding of how simmed stats come about?

    Does the computer actually go through and actually run through full game scenarios or are the stats just based on the ratings of the player and some other outside numbers.

    Has anyone every gone simmed a season and taken a player like Pujols and put him at leadoff to see how his stats would be impacted? Would he still drive in 130-ish runs or would it drop down to like 80 or 90?

    I'm just wondering how the computer lineup problem changes stats the occur outside of the games you actually play..over the course of a season.

      No, there is nothing like that.

      As for the original question, this is just educated guessing, but I don't think it actually simmed through each game, based solely on the speed with which you could sim through a season. Games like MVP series, and MLB Power Pros, both actually simmed each game, and it took FOREVER.

      2K7 and previous 2K games have been able to sim seasons much faster than this, leading me to believe that each game is not actually simmed out, but that some formula is used to determine stats over the course of a simmed game/season.

      But yeah, I'm pretty sure players' numbers are effected by where you bat them in the order. So Pujols batting leadoff would most likely have many fewer RBIs, but probably more runs.
